[quote=Anonymous][quote=Anonymous]Your pediatrician should be the one to discuss this with. Other people’s kids’ growth isn’t very relevant to yours. [/quote] +1 Also your pediatrician can check your son’s current height against his individual growth curve and see if he’s progressing as expected. Growth spurts tend to coincide with stages of puberty and based on where your son is on that scale the doctor can advise if he has a lot more height growth to come. There’s always variability but you can determine if his growth is as expected or not.[/quote]
